Tex. Lab. Code § 305.021

TUITION ASSISTANCE GRANT; AMOUNT OF GRANT

Added by Acts 2001, 77th Leg., ch. 713, Sec. 1, eff

(a) The commission may provide tuition assistance grants to Texas residents enrolled in a qualified education program at an eligible institution.

(b) In selecting applicants to receive grants under this chapter and the amount of the grant for each applicant, the commission may consider:

(1) the financial need and resources of an applicant;

(2) the state's need for workforce development in the applicant's proposed career field;

(3) the efficient use of the money available for grants;

(4) the fair allocation of grants to promote workforce development in different career fields;

(5) the opportunity of applicants from all regions of this state to receive financial assistance under this chapter; and

(6) any other factor the commission considers appropriate to further the purposes of this chapter.
